The Role of Radio in Homefront Communication

The radio emerged as a pivotal technology influencing homefront communication during wartime. Serving as a primary conduit for information, it enabled families to stay abreast of developments on the battlefield, facilitating a connection between soldiers and their supporters at home.

Radio broadcasts disseminated news quickly, minimizing the uncertainty that often gripped homefront communities. Regular updates on troop movements, victories, or losses fostered a sense of involvement and morale among civilians, contributing to national unity.

In addition to news reports, radio programs featured morale-boosting music, entertainment, and public service announcements. These broadcasts played a significant role in shaping public perception of the war effort, while also encouraging participation in initiatives like rationing and war bonds.

The impact of technology on homefront communication was profound, as the radio transformed how families engaged with the ongoing conflict. By bridging the gap between the front lines and civilian life, radio helped create an informed and resilient homefront society during times of adversity.

Technological Innovations in Food Preservation

During wartime, technological innovations in food preservation played a significant role in ensuring food security for the home front. Techniques such as canning, dehydration, and refrigeration became vital, enabling families to store perishable goods and maintain a steady food supply amid scarcity.

Canning, developed in the early 19th century but popularized during wartime, involved sealing food in airtight containers. This process drastically extended the shelf life of fruits, vegetables, and meats, allowing them to be stored long-term. The emergence of commercial canning facilities further facilitated access to preserved food for households.

Dehydration also became essential, utilizing heat to remove moisture from food, thereby inhibiting bacterial growth. Soldiers and families benefitted from dehydrated items like fruits and vegetables, which could be easily transported and stored.

Refrigeration, though not new, saw advancements that improved food preservation on the home front. The use of iceboxes and later electric refrigerators allowed perishable items such as dairy and meats to remain fresh for extended periods, contributing to improved nutrition and dietary variety during challenging times.

The Influence of Propaganda Through Technology

Propaganda through technology during wartime served as a powerful tool for influencing public perception and boosting morale. The rapid advancements in communication technologies enabled governments to disseminate messages quickly and effectively, shaping the narrative around the war effort.

Broadcasting methods, such as radio and film, became essential for reaching a broad audience. These platforms allowed authorities to engage citizens directly, fostering a sense of unity and purpose. Key functions of technological propaganda included:

  • Promoting patriotism through emotionally charged messages.
  • Encouraging enlistment and war bonds to fund military operations.
  • Discrediting opponents while showcasing victories and advancements.

Moreover, printed materials like posters targeted specific demographics to mobilize the homefront. Propaganda aimed to create a favorable image of the military and to highlight the importance of civilian contributions. This integration of technology amplified the impact of propaganda, solidifying its role in the broader context of the homefront during wartime. Through these innovations, the influence of propaganda on public sentiment became an integral aspect of the war effort.
